Transponder Keys

Transponder chips are typically found in cars made within the last 20 years. This is a measure of security that can deter theft by making it difficult for thieves to hot wire your vehicle. This is because the chip in the transponder key transmits an electronic signal that is read by the ignition switch. The engine can't be started without this signal, and anyone who tries to break through your locks and tries to start your car will likely fail.

If your key has chips inside the chip is typically bigger than a conventional flat metal key. The head of the keys includes a microchip that can be read by the radio frequency scanner in the ignition. The transponder responds to this signal with an unique digital identification number that is only activated if the key is located in close proximity to the vehicle. The car's computer recognizes this unique identification code and allows the engine to run. Many high-security locks have cylinders that are protected from duplication. These locks are typically made with unique pins that make them harder to pick them or open them. They can also be secured with hardened, solid materials to stop drilling and other forms of forced entry. These are the essential features to consider when selecting a product for your office or home.

Some high-security keys also come with cards that must be presented to get a duplicate created. These cards are usually restricted to key makers and stop any unauthorised key replication.
